DHACU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review
8 of the 6,360 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Digital Health Acquisition Corp. Unit (DHACU)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$2.87M — down 96% from $77.6M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 30 funds closed out of DHACU and 2 opened new positions — a net loss of 28 holders — while 3 trimmed existing stakes and 1 added.
The largest buyer was State Street, opening a new position worth an estimated $189K. The largest seller was Starboard Value, exiting entirely with an estimated $7.17M sold.
